Henrikh Mkhitaryan: You can see I'm happy in Roma if you look at how I play

15:05   13 January, 2021

Midfielder for the Armenia national football team Henrikh Mkhitaryan says he will start talks with Roma to extend his contract soon. The 31-year-old footballer’s contract ends after this season and, according to Italian presses, the parties will extend the contract for a year.

“Roma believed in me. If you see how I play, you will notice that I am happy to be here. I don’t have time to talk about the contract now. A few days ago, we played with Internazionale, and our match with Lazio is coming up. We’ll talk soon,” Mkhitaryan said, Football Italia reported.

Henrikh Mkhitaryan moved from Arsenal to Roma in September 2020. During this championship, he has participated in 17 matches, scored 8 goals and made 8 passes for goals.

The senior member of the Armenia national football team has also played for Yerevan’s FC Pyunik (2006-09), FC Metalurh Donetsk (2009-10), FC Shakhtar Donetsk (2010-13), Borussia Dortmund (2013-16) and Manchester United (2016-18).
